Transaction 2115182b50c293a63a0bd44a1349b06a26597a737caec0af38ceda3823cf87a9
1 Input
1 Output
-
2115182b50c293a63a0bd44a1349b06a26597a737caec0af38ceda3823cf87a9:0
- value
- 31838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8680918899a31e59a7b407747941c7796aec5cb4 OP_EQUAL
- address
- 3DxCVLvhN2SqzG5u29F1w8Pv8ZkhxXCTsX